Metro police are hoping people driving through Nashville will help them catch fugitives.
The department has teamed up with Lamar Advertising to post fugitive photos and information on four billboards in Nashville.
The billboards now feature Jeremy Duffer, who is charged with seven counts of child rape and other crimes.
Duffer freed himself of his GPS monitoring bracelet in February. His last reported sighting was in April.
Metro Police Chief Ronal Sergas says hundreds of thousands of cars will pass the billboards each day.
“It doesn’t matter where we think he is; we don’t know exactly where he is, so if he is anywhere in and around this area and somebody drives by that billboard and sees him, they may call us and that is what we hope for and that is what we’d like to see come out of this.”
Duffer’s photo will remain on the billboards until he is caught and then information on another fugitive will appear.
